In this message, Pastor Ruttan explores Romans 8:18-30, a deep passage penned by the apostle Paul about having hope through hardship, and God’s big picture vision that is meant to give us perspective for whatever we’re dealing with. It’s a message that might resonate with us in a particularly significant way at this gloomy time of year! He shared text in this passage that is helpful for us to know that;
1/ Good things are coming (Remember, when you have something good to look forward to, it softens the blow of what you’re currently going through.)
2/ God helps you when you can’t help yourself (and even when you think you can)
3/ Love God, and trust him to do good things even when you can’t see beyond the fog
